Industrial Cylindrical Type Lithium Manganese Dioxide Battery Market

The global market for Industrial Cylindrical Type Lithium Manganese Dioxide Battery was valued at US$ million in the year 2024 and is projected to reach a revised size of US$ million by 2031, growing at a CAGR of %during the forecast period.
North American market for Industrial Cylindrical Type Lithium Manganese Dioxide Battery is estimated to increase from $ million in 2024 to reach $ million by 2031, at a CAGR of % during the forecast period of 2025 through 2031.
Asia-Pacific market for Industrial Cylindrical Type Lithium Manganese Dioxide Battery is estimated to increase from $ million in 2024 to reach $ million by 2031, at a CAGR of % during the forecast period of 2025 through 2031.
The major global manufacturers of Industrial Cylindrical Type Lithium Manganese Dioxide Battery include Hitachi Maxell, Energizer, Panasonic, EVE Energy, SAFT, Duracell, FDK, Huizhou Huiderui Lithium Battery Technology Co., Ltd, Vitzrocell, HCB Battery Co., Ltd, etc. In 2024, the world's top three vendors accounted for approximately % of the revenue.
